项目简介
随着服务器开发和维护复杂度的提升,系统环境管理愈发重要。本项目基于Bash开发了名为“.msconfig”的工具,可让开发者对服务器进行模块化的插件添加和加载项引入,提升开发效率,简化服务器配置流程。
项目的主要特性和功能
- 支持模块化插件管理,满足多样化需求。
- 可引入各种环境配置,轻松管理不同开发环境。
- 具备load和init功能模块,登录后自动加载和初始化脚本。
- 提供数据存放路径,保证运行产生的持久化和临时文件有序存放。
- 提供额外帮助工具,如安装工具和周期函数等。
安装使用步骤
- 下载项目源码文件并解压。
- 将解压后的“.msconfig”文件夹置于用户文件夹(即"~"目录)。
- 在终端执行以下命令使.msconfig可用:
bash if [ -d ~/.msconfig ]; then export PATH="~/.msconfig/startup/env":$PATH fi
或在~/.bashrc
文件末尾添加相应内容,实现开机自动配置。 - 若需安装更多功能或插件,参照项目内其他文件夹和脚本配置操作。可在“scripts”文件夹找特定功能脚本定制使用,“helper”文件夹的辅助工具能提供额外帮助,按项目指南操作。
- 安装完成后,使用提供的命令启动和管理配置文件。例如,运行
bash msconfig.install.sh install
安装或更新配置文件管理器。 - “config”文件夹存放配置和数据文件,“data”文件夹存放运行产生的持久化和临时文件,按实际需求配置管理。
下载地址
点击下载 【提取码: 4003】【解压密码: www.makuang.net】